Auteur Sujet: Programmation PIC et adaptation au circuit bending et DIY  (Lu 14312 fois)

Geek Rivers (ex 1.6.4)

  • Vicomte des Abysses
  • *
  • Messages: 461
Programmation PIC et adaptation au circuit bending et DIY « Réponse #15 le: janvier 23, 2011, 17:38:31 pm »
tuto en françqis

http://www.acoupel.com/MIDI%20CV%20Gate/firmware/firmware_midifr.htm

ça c'est pas mal je viens enfin de comprendre le code midi pour envoyer ce que l'on veut comme message avec cette page et les suivantes...

http://hinton-instruments.co.uk/reference/midi/protocol/index.htm


et pour multiplier démultiplier avec arduino

http://www.arduino.cc/en/Tutorial/ShiftOut

http://www.arduino.cc/en/Tutorial/ShiftIn.

tout s'éclaire enfin....

NCP

  • Taboulé Minceur
  • *
  • Messages: 2
Programmation PIC et adaptation au circuit bending et DIY « Réponse #16 le: janvier 28, 2011, 09:44:34 am »
Salut a tous, vous avez l'air de vous y connaitre pas mal en programmation de PIC, moi je débute en electronique et je souhaiterais m'y mettre.

Je compose des petites mélodies entêtantes qu'on peu faire tourner en boucle, et je souhaiterais les transférer sur PIC pour faire des petites boites à musique.

Mais j'ai un petit souci, je travaille sous linux (Open Mint) avec LMMS, apparement déjà beaucoup de matos sont pas compatibles. Je voudrais savoir quel programmateur de PIC je dois acheter et quel logiciels utiliser. Y a t'il eventuellement moyen de programmer un PIC sans passer par l'ordi ?

Par ailleurs sur le principe de programmation du PIC lui même, comment ont fait pour écrire des notes de musiques et combien un PIC peut jouer de notes en même temps ?

oyster_twister

  • Carnivorous Salami
  • *
  • Messages: 84
Programmation PIC et adaptation au circuit bending et DIY « Réponse #17 le: janvier 29, 2011, 12:31:58 pm »
Salut NCP et bienvenu,

Je suis pas spécialiste en PIC, mais j'ai fais 2 ou 3 trucs avec Arduino, qui si je dis pas trop de conneries, pourrait faire l'affaire pour tes histoires... J'ai vu des projets de types qui font des synthes avec arduino:
http://anthonymattox.com/arduino-synthesizer
http://code.google.com/p/tinkerit/wiki/Auduino

arduino fonctionne sous linux.

Edit : travailler sous linux n'est pas un soucis  smiley23
http://www.micahcarrick.com/pic-programming-linux.html

NCP

  • Taboulé Minceur
  • *
  • Messages: 2
Programmation PIC et adaptation au circuit bending et DIY « Réponse #18 le: janvier 29, 2011, 19:55:09 pm »
Je viens de regarder quelques sites, effectivement Arduino à l'air compatible avec Linux UBUNTU par contre ça à l'air bien galère a installer surtout que je suis sur Open Mint une distrib dérivé d'UBUNTU enfin j'espère que ça passera.

Par contre au niveau de l'Arduino lui même ya plusieurs cartes et je sais pas trop ce que je dois prendre pour débuter (je pense me connecter en USB et c'est uniquement pour programmer des PICs musicaux)

Après au niveau des PICs eux mêmes je sais pas non plus trop quoi prendre ce serait pour des boucles mélodiques d'environ 30s avec j'usqu'a 4 notes joués à la fois.

Si quelqu'un peut m'éclairer au fond du garage

 smiley11

Valkiri

  • Human Pâté
  • *
  • Messages: 120

oyster_twister

  • Carnivorous Salami
  • *
  • Messages: 84
Programmation PIC et adaptation au circuit bending et DIY « Réponse #20 le: février 01, 2011, 10:11:16 am »
normalement aucun problème, pour arduino sous linux. Tu aura besoin de gcc à installé si pas déjà.
Pour les cartes prend la plus classique arduino duemilanove (le dernier modèle uno à tendance à cafouiller sous linux).
Tu devrais pouvoir trouver la duemilanoove sur des sites comme lextronic.

Après pour ton projet musical, tu n'auras plus qu'à suivre les topics de synthé DIY avec arduino, je pense que le code est ouvert pour ces projets. (le code arduino est assez simple à prendre en main).

@Valkiri:
pour le MPS430, je connaissais pas, j'ai fais une requête sur la liste des geeks nantais pour voir s'il y a du retour. je te tiens au jus.

Geek Rivers (ex 1.6.4)

  • Vicomte des Abysses
  • *
  • Messages: 461
Programmation PIC et adaptation au circuit bending et DIY « Réponse #21 le: février 01, 2011, 22:51:47 pm »
Y'a moyen si on veut rester cheap (pas de tune) de monter des carte arduino artisanal sur carte d'essaie, il faut bien sur avoir les composant, et une carte arduino pour pouvoir faire les transferts de code, c'est plus avantageux que le launchpad je pense, vu la communauté qu'il y a derrière...

oyster_twister

  • Carnivorous Salami
  • *
  • Messages: 84
Programmation PIC et adaptation au circuit bending et DIY « Réponse #22 le: février 02, 2011, 13:36:39 pm »
yep,

suis d'accord.
L'avantage avec arduino hormis la communauté biensur, c'est le fait que l'on peut en avoir qu'une pour programmer et aprés...zou ! on change la puce atmel et on passe à la suivante.
C'est d'ailleurs comme ça que fonctionne un programmeur PIC j'imagine, seulement Arduino ne font pas trop de pub à ce sujet, il vaut mieux acheter une plaquette pour chacun de nos projets  smiley4  alors que ce n'est vraiment pas nécessaire.